WebMar 28, 2024 · Earthjustice is an environmental non-profit that uses the power of law to protect people and the planet. Its areas of focus include the wild (both land and life), healthy communities and clean energy. When you donate to Earthjustice, 79 percent of every dollar goes directly to fund program work. WebEarthjustice Action is a 501(c)(4) organization dedicated to supporting the work of Earthjustice's 501(c)(3) efforts on behalf of our environment and people. Earthjustice Action does not endorse candidates for elected office. Please note: Contributions to Earthjustice Action are not tax deductible.
